什么是Gitpod?
DevSpaces 是一个创新工具,旨在通过允许开发者将开发环境描述为代码,从而简化开发过程。这个强大的应用程序能够为托管在 GitLab、GitHub 和 Bitbucket 上的项目创建完全预构建的开发环境。借助 DevSpaces,开发者可以在几秒钟内启动他们的代码并开始工作,消除下载代码和配置本地环境的繁琐过程。这一现代解决方案提高了生产力,促进了更顺畅的工作流程。
Gitpod的核心功能有哪些?
- 无缝集成: DevSpaces 与流行的代码仓库如 GitHub、GitLab 和 Bitbucket 无缝集成,使开发者能够无须额外设置即可访问他们的项目。
- 预构建环境: 用户可以生成包含项目所需的所有依赖项、库和工具的完全预配置开发环境。
- 基于容器的 IDE: 该平台利用基于容器的集成开发环境(IDE),提供一致和统一的工作空间。
- 即时代码启动: 开发者可以立即开始编码,无需本地设置和配置的延迟,从而允许快速迭代和减少停机时间。
- 跨平台兼容性: 作为云原生产品,DevSpaces 可以在各种操作系统和设备上运行,成为拥有多样化环境团队的理想选择。
- 版本控制友好: 工具与版本控制系统兼容,确保在开发周期内跟踪和高效管理所有更改。
Gitpod的特性是什么?
- 用户友好的界面: DevSpaces 拥有直观的界面,适合初学者和经验丰富的开发者,促进更顺利的入门体验。
- 高效驱动的功能: 该平台的构建以性能为重点,优化开发过程,帮助团队更快实现目标。
- 协作工具: DevSpaces 通过提供多位开发者同时在同一项目上工作的功能,促进团队协作。
- 灵活性和可扩展性: 无论您是处理小型项目还是管理大型应用,DevSpaces 都会根据您的需求进行扩展。
Gitpod的使用案例有哪些?
- 快速原型开发: 对于寻求快速创建原型的初创公司和个人开发者,DevSpaces 在无需本地环境设置的情况下,支持快速迭代。
- 教育用途: 教育机构可以利用 DevSpaces 进行编码培训和计算机科学课程,确保所有学生都能访问相同的环境。
- 远程协作: 分布在不同地理位置的团队可以使用 DevSpaces 维护一致的开发环境,从而增强协作和沟通。
- 开放源代码贡献: 对于参与开放源代码项目的开发者,可以快速为各种代码库设置环境,方便进行无缝贡献。
如何使用Gitpod?
要开始使用 DevSpaces:
- 安装扩展程序: 通过 Chrome 网上应用店将 DevSpaces 添加到您的 Chrome 浏览器。
- 连接到您的仓库: 将您的 GitHub、GitLab 或 Bitbucket 账户集成,以允许 DevSpaces 访问您的项目。
- 启动您的项目: 选择您希望工作的代码仓库,并在 DevSpaces 提供的预构建容器基础 IDE 中启动它。
- 开始编码: 立即开始您的编码旅程,利用为您的项目需求量身定制的环境。
Gitpod联系邮箱:
如有疑问或需支持,请通过电子邮件联系 [email protected]。